כיצד פועלים Joins?
כיצד פועלים Joins?

וִידֵאוֹ: כיצד פועלים Joins?

וִידֵאוֹ: כיצד פועלים Joins?
וִידֵאוֹ: תנועות אחרונות בנק הפועלים 2024, נוֹבֶמבֶּר
Anonim

SQL לְהִצְטַרֵף סעיף - המקביל לא לְהִצְטַרֵף פעולה באלגברה יחסית - משלבת עמודות מטבלה אחת או יותר במסד נתונים יחסי. זה יוצר סט שניתן לשמור כטבלה או להשתמש בו כפי שהוא. א לְהִצְטַרֵף הוא אמצעי לשילוב עמודות מאחד (עצמי לְהִצְטַרֵף ) או יותר טבלאות באמצעות ערכים משותפים לכל אחת מהן.

מזה, מתי להשתמש ב-join?

הסעיף של SQL Joins משמש לשילוב רשומות משתי טבלאות או יותר במסד נתונים. א לְהִצְטַרֵף הוא אמצעי לשילוב שדות משתי טבלאות על ידי באמצעות ערכים משותפים לכל אחד.

יודע גם איך עובדת הצטרפות מלאה? א הצטרפות מלאה מחזירה את כל השורות מהטבלאות המצורפות, בין אם הן הם תואם או לא, כלומר אתה פחית לומר א הצטרפות מלאה משלב את הפונקציות של שמאל לְהִצְטַרֵף וזכות לְהִצְטַרֵף . הצטרפות מלאה היא סוג של חיצוני לְהִצְטַרֵף בגלל זה הוא מכונה גם מלא חִיצוֹנִי לְהִצְטַרֵף.

דע גם, מה זה הצטרף לדוגמא?

א לְהִצְטַרֵף הסעיף משמש לשילוב שורות משתי טבלאות או יותר, בהתבסס על עמודה קשורה ביניהן. שימו לב שהעמודה "מזהה לקוח" בטבלה "הזמנות" מתייחסת ל"מזהה לקוח" בטבלה "לקוחות". הקשר בין שתי הטבלאות לעיל הוא העמודה "מזהה לקוח".

האם נוכל לחבר שני טבלאות ללא כל קשר?

כן אנחנו יכולים . שום סעיף לא אומר את זה בשביל הִצטָרְפוּת שֶׁל שתיים או יותר שולחנות חייב להיות א מפתח זר או אילוץ מפתח ראשי. ל להצטרף אלינו צריך לעמוד בתנאים באמצעות על או איפה סעיף לפי הדרישות שלנו.

מוּמלָץ: